SEMA 2008: Cobra Jet Mustang arrives straight from dragstrip, 400-hp figure explained

Ford apparently brought the FR500CJ Cobra Jet Mustang to SEMA straight from one of its testing sessions, because there was still plenty of shredded Goodyear rubber lining the fenders behind the rear wheels. The graphics package looks fantastic in person, and we're jealous of the 50 lucky owners who have already placed their orders for the car. Many of you have been wondering, and we've asked the question ourselves, why the Cobra Jet is "only" rated at 400 horsepower.
